In 2024, this limit was established at $5,030. As soon as you and your strategy spend that amount on Part D drugs, you have gone into the donut opening and will certainly pay 25% for medications going onward. Once your out-of-pocket costs reach the 2nd limit of $8,000 in 2024, you run out the donut hole, and "devastating insurance coverage" begins.


In 2025, the donut hole will certainly be largely gotten rid of for a $2,000 restriction on out-of-pocket Part D drug spending. Once you strike that limit, you'll pay absolutely nothing else out of pocket for the year. If you only have Medicare Parts A and B, you could consider additional private insurance to aid cover your out-of-pocket expenses such as copays, coinsurance, and deductibles.


While Medicare Component C functions as a choice to your original Medicare strategy, Medigap collaborates with Components A and B and aids complete any coverage spaces. There are a few vital things to know about Medigap. You should have Medicare Components A and B prior to getting a Medigap plan, as it is a supplement to Medicare and not a stand-alone policy.


Medicare has actually developed throughout the years and now has 4 parts. If you're age 65 or older and get Social Safety and security, you'll instantly be enrolled partly A, which covers hospitalization prices. Parts B (outpatient services) and D (prescription medication advantages) are voluntary, though under certain situations you might be instantly enrolled in either or both of these.
